The Rock and Roll world has a popular motto that many rockstars have religiously followed. And that's this: "It's better to burn out than rust out!" Now, that might make for good rock legends, but it's a horrible maxim to live by if you’re a business owner or entrepreneur. Today, Den gives many shiny pearls of wisdom when it comes to pacing yourself so you can actually achieve your goals without sacrificing your time, money, health, and family.
